Special needs students may require accommodations such as extra time on assignments or tests, preferential seating in the classroom, use of assistive technology, modified assignments or assessments, and access to support services like counseling or speech therapy. These accommodations help to create a more inclusive and equitable learning environment for students with diverse needs.

What does a educational diagnostician do?

An educational diagnostician assesses students who may have learning disabilities or other educational challenges to determine their specific needs and make recommendations for appropriate interventions or accommodations. They work closely with teachers, parents, and other professionals to develop individualized education plans that support student success.


What does is mean if a child is statemented?

Being "statemented" typically refers to a child having an Education, Health, and Care Plan (EHCP) in the UK. This is a legal document that outlines a child's special educational needs and the support they require. It is used to ensure that the child receives appropriate assistance and accommodations in their education.
